Avon & Somerset: Appeal following fatal RTC

September 19, 2012, 3:13 pm

We are appealing for witnesses and information following a road traffic collision on the A37 at Chelwood.

The incident occurred at 2pm today and involved a car and a lorry. The driver of the car died at the scene.

We would ask urge motorists to avoid the area at this time as the road will be closed until at least 5pm to allow officers to carry out their investigation.

Anyone with any information on this incident is asked to contact the collision investigation unit on 101 or call Crimestoppers on 0800 555 111.
